What is the difference between No Experience 3D Modeling vs 3D Animator?

AspectNo Experience 3D Modeling3D Animator
Required SkillsBasic understanding of 3D modeling software, no prior experience neededKnowledge of animation principles, some modeling skills beneficial
Work EnvironmentEntry-level, often in training or internship settingsCreative studios, gaming, film, or advertising industries
CertificationsNone typically required, but beginner courses helpfulPortfolio and some industry-specific training preferred

While No Experience 3D Modeling focuses on learning the fundamentals of creating 3D objects, 3D Animators build upon that by bringing models to life through movement and storytelling. Both roles often overlap in entry-level positions, but 3D Animators usually require additional skills in animation techniques and software.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a 3D Modeler with no prior experience, and why are they important?

To thrive as a 3D Modeler with no experience, you need a basic understanding of 3D concepts, strong spatial awareness, and a willingness to learn, often supported by self-study or entry-level courses. Familiarity with industry-standard software such as Blender, SketchUp, or Autodesk Maya is important, and free tutorials or certifications can help build these skills. Creativity, attention to detail, and perseverance are valuable soft skills that set beginners apart in tackling complex modeling tasks. Developing these abilities allows newcomers to create visually appealing models and build a solid portfolio, which is essential for career growth in the 3D modeling field.

What is no experience 3D modeling?

No experience 3D modeling refers to the process of creating digital three-dimensional objects using specialized software, even if you have no prior background or training in the field. Beginners can learn the basics of 3D modeling through online tutorials, courses, and beginner-friendly software like Blender or Tinkercad. These tools and resources are designed to help newcomers develop foundational skills and create simple models, which can be used for games, animations, 3D printing, or personal projects.

What types of entry-level 3D modeling projects can I expect to work on when starting with no experience?

As a beginner in 3D modeling, you'll likely start with simpler tasks such as creating basic shapes, assisting with texture mapping, or building low-poly models for backgrounds or prototypes. These tasks help you become familiar with industry-standard software and workflows. You'll often work closely with more experienced modelers, receiving feedback and gradually taking on more complex assignments as your skills improve. Entry-level roles also provide opportunities to learn about collaboration, version control, and how your work fits into the larger production pipeline.

Job description

Parallax Studios is looking for an experienced Rhino 3D Modeling Supervisor to help lead a large-scale architectural and environmental visualization project. This role is heavily focused on team coordination, asset tracking, file organization, and maintaining consistency across a multi-artist pipeline.
We are looking for someone who is highly organized, proactive, detail-oriented, and comfortable managing both people and production workflows in a fast-paced creative environment.
Project Overview
  • Large-scale architectural development featuring highly organic facilities
  • Scope includes both exterior and interior modeling
  • Models will be built natively in Rhino to support seamless conversion into Revit for subsequent design phases
  • Estimated 15-26 weeks of remote, full-time production
  • Project-based / freelance with potential for continued collaboration
Responsibilities
  • Oversee day-to-day modeling production across a team of 13-15 artists
  • Track asset progress, priorities, approvals, and deliveries
  • Maintain clean file structures, naming conventions, and version control
  • Coordinate handoffs between modeling, layout, rendering, and downstream teams
  • Ensure consistency and quality across all 3D assets
  • Help identify production bottlenecks and proactively solve workflow issues
  • Communicate clearly with production and creative leadership regarding status and needs
  • Support onboarding and guidance for artists throughout the project
Requirements
  • Strong experience supervising or coordinating 3D modeling teams
  • Excellent organizational and communication skills
  • Proven ability to manage complex file ecosystems and multi-artist workflows
  • Comfortable tracking large numbers of assets and deliverables across multiple deadlines
  • Experience working in architectural visualization, themed entertainment, VFX, or related industries
  • Strong understanding of 3D production pipelines and best practices
  • Comfortable working in a fast-paced production environment
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ience with Rhino-to-Revit workflows
  • Familiarity with architectural or construction-based modeling pipelines
  • Experience coordinating large environment or masterplan-style projects
